Venting in the comparative study of flexural ultrasonic transducers to improve resilience at elevated environmental pressure levels [PDF]
The classical form of a flexural ultrasonic transducer is a piezoelectric ceramic disc bonded to a circular metallic membrane. This ceramic induces vibration modes of the membrane for the generation and detection of ultrasound.
